A minimal-degree polynomial for determining the volume of an octahedron from its metric.

This note discusses the derivation of a polynomial for the volume of a octahedron, when the edge lengths of it are given. It is known that the volume of a flexible polyhedron with those edge lengths doesn't depend on the realization. For octahedra there are 8 realizations, and therefore the polynomial that describes the volume must have degree 8. The derivation of this polynomial is done by using a computer algebra system.
